Frequently Asked Questions

Who earns more, a Building and civil engineering technicians or a Crane drivers?
A Crane drivers earns more. The median salary for a Building and civil engineering technicians is £36,495, whilst a Crane drivers earns £45,971 — a difference of £9,476 per year.
What is the salary difference between a Building and civil engineering technicians and a Crane drivers?
The difference is £9,476 per year. Crane drivers is the higher-paid role.
